Output 1953c8865acea31c96890f029f0d525b5146fe6e27b19e532b2c9d47d54e4e10:0

value
6981717410538
script pubkey
OP_0 OP_PUSHBYTES_20 eb8f5ba3847140f4512a1bbcd2a46d474d53c379
address
tb1qaw84hguyw9q0g5f2rw7d9frdgax48smejlq3jm
transaction
1953c8865acea31c96890f029f0d525b5146fe6e27b19e532b2c9d47d54e4e10
confirmations
177400
spent
true